Tabla de contenido:

¿Cómo optimizo un modelo de TensorFlow?
¿Cómo optimizo un modelo de TensorFlow?

Video: ¿Cómo optimizo un modelo de TensorFlow?

Video: ¿Cómo optimizo un modelo de TensorFlow?
Video: Aprende a PROGRAMAR una RED NEURONAL - Tensorflow, Keras, Sklearn 2024, Noviembre
Anonim

Técnicas de optimización

  1. Reduzca el recuento de parámetros con poda y poda estructurada.
  2. Reduzca la precisión de la representación con la cuantificación.
  3. Actualizar el original modelo topología a una más eficiente con parámetros reducidos o ejecución más rápida. Por ejemplo, métodos de descomposición tensorial y destilación.

En este sentido, ¿qué es un modelo de optimización?

modelo de optimización . tipo de matemática modelo que intenta optimizar (maximizar o minimizar) una función objetivo sin violar las limitaciones de recursos; también conocida como programación matemática. Modelos de optimización incluyen Programación Lineal (LP).

Además, ¿qué es el modelo TensorFlow? Introducción. TensorFlow La publicación es un sistema de publicación flexible y de alto rendimiento para el aprendizaje automático. modelos , diseñado para entornos de producción. TensorFlow Serving facilita la implementación de nuevos algoritmos y experimentos, mientras se mantiene la misma arquitectura de servidor y API.

Además de esto, ¿qué es la optimización en el aprendizaje automático?

Mejoramiento es el ingrediente más esencial en la receta de aprendizaje automático algoritmos. Comienza definiendo algún tipo de función de pérdida / función de costo y termina minimizándola usando una u otra mejoramiento rutina.

¿TensorFlow es de código abierto?

TensorFlow es un fuente abierta biblioteca de software para el cálculo numérico utilizando gráficos de flujo de datos. TensorFlow es multiplataforma. Se ejecuta en casi todo: GPU y CPU, incluidas las plataformas móviles e integradas, e incluso las unidades de procesamiento tensorial (TPU), que son hardware especializado para realizar cálculos tensoriales.

Recomendado: